723408004: Multifocal pattern dystrophy of retinal pigment epithelium simulating fundus flavimaculatus (disorder)

5403045013 A rare, patterned dystrophy of the retinal pigment epithelium characterized by multiple yellowish irregular flecks scattered or interconnected around the macula, simulating what is observed in Stargardt disease, and usually asymptomatic until adulthood when patients present with a slowly progressive loss of vision that often only becomes apparent in old age. en Definition Active Entire term case sensitive (core metadata concept) SNOMED CT core
